I connected a 15 Ohm 5 W resistor at the output. Without this load, i got about 8.7 VDC. That complies with 6 x √ 2. With the 15 Ohm load it's about 7.4 VDC. No ripple. I guess that's good enough for the LT1963's.
I use four of them. 5V for the DAC, 5V, 3V3 and 1V8 for the Pi. Each LT1963 will be supplied with the raw voltage coming from the rectifier. I'll have to dive in the circuitry of the DAC to bypass the onboard 3V3 stabilizer too, and adjust the 5V for the DAC at 3V3.
